Bite Problems
Dealing with bite concerns is crucial for appropriate positioning and feature of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ite problems, it is very important to look for orthodontic treatment to attend to the issue.
Right here are three typical bite issues and how they can be taken care of:
1. Overbite: An overbite happens when your upper front teeth overlap significantly with your reduced front teeth. This can lead to problems with attacking and eating. Orthodontic treatment, such as dental braces or Invisalign, can help correct an overbite by gradually relocating the teeth into their correct placement.
2. Underbite: An underbite is when your reduced front teeth stick out before your top teeth. This can affect the look of your smile and can create problems with attacking and eating. Orthodontic treatment may entail using braces or other devices to change the reduced teeth back and straighten them appropriately with the top teeth.
3. Crossbite: A crossbite is when your top teeth rest inside your reduced teeth when you bite down. This can cause irregular endure the teeth and can bring about jaw pain. Orthodontic therapy for a crossbite might entail using dental braces or other home appliances to realign the teeth and fix the bite.
Misaligned Jaw
If you have a misaligned jaw, orthodontic treatment can help realign it for boosted bite and jaw feature. A misaligned jaw occurs when the top and reduced jaws do not meet correctly. This can cause various problems, such as difficulty eating, talking, and even breathing.
Orthodontists can utilize different strategies to remedy a misaligned jaw, relying on the severity of the issue. One common technique is utilizing braces or aligners to slowly shift the setting of the teeth and line up the jaws. In extra severe instances, orthognathic surgical procedure may be needed to reposition the jawbones and attain appropriate positioning.
It is very important to speak with an orthodontist to identify the best therapy prepare for your misaligned jaw.
